Subject: Handover — cold bucket archiving

Renna,

Taking over Glacierline archiving from tonight. Cold buckets older than 180 days get compacted weekly; the job runs from the ops box, logs to the archive manifest table. Review the compaction script before Thursday's run — I changed the batch size to 500 and dropped the retry loop. Manifest rows are never deleted, only flagged. The manifest lives in the catalog database, reachable via the string below.

primary connection of yagep-kahip = redis://giliel_svc:zYiKsLL2PLpfPL@db-348f.xolmarsys.corp:5432/fenwyn

Minutes — Management Meeting, Brastell Manufacturing

Attendees: heads of department. Topic: renewal of the Kelwick Components supply contract. Pricing up 4%; delivery terms unchanged. Procurement to push for volume rebates by Friday. Quality complaints from the Ashfold line noted; clause added. Renewal recommended for two years. Decision deferred pending the confidential business note appended below.

board note of fahog-bawep: The renewal with Holixax Holdings closes at $20 million a year, 20 percent below the last contract. Project Druwyn slips by two quarters because of the supplier delay.

Document Transport — Courier Change After Missed Pick-up

Scope: applies when a scheduled courier misses a pick-up at any Delvane Brothers site.

Coordinator actions: log the miss, notify the sending office, and book a replacement run with Ostfield Express within two hours. Void the original manifest number and issue a new one. Brief the replacement driver on route, seal numbers, and timing. The replacement courier must confirm the hand-over instruction stated directly below before any package is released.

handover note for yagef-bagep: the drudor pelius courier leaves the kasdor zorvan norir ledger at gate 8016 under passcode 755406